On Saturday I got married. My friends made a perfect day both hilarious and authentic by securing and reading a statement from Houston Rockets General Manager Daryl Morey during the wedding ceremony.

I grew up going to Houston Rockets games at the Summit, then the Toyota Center. I listened to the 1994 championship on the radio from a Boy Scout summer camp. The 1995 title I watched while standing on a coffee table.
During college I once looked up from a card table in a less-than-licensed Houston poker house and recognized Matt Maloney taking a seat at the table.
At the age of 33, I can still wear the Clyde Drexler blue jersey I got for my birthday in middle school. I’m the monster who owns a Rockets jersey for their cat and for the past five years I’ve been an erratic writer for The Dream Shake.
By reasonable metrics I qualify as a lifelong Rockets fan.
Life takes some fun turns. I left Houston 11 years ago and have lived in 7 states since then. I’m elated to have fallen in love with my wife and her home state of Montana, where we live.
Imagine my surprise when standing in a field on a Montana mountain top, a friend I’ve had since elementary school breaks out a tongue-in-cheek congratulatory wedding statement from Daryl Morey during the ceremony.
My dad and I loved it.
I have to thank Dr. Sam Cook who secured the statement and is the pride of Edinburg, Texas, and Michael Jaynes, a lifelong friend who owned the Dreamcast we played countless matches of NBA 2K on. Not NBA 2K the series, the original NBA 2K with Allen Iverson on the cover.
Oh yes, and Daryl Morey. Not only is he the NBA’s best general manager, but someone who is clearly willing to embrace his strange celebrity and allow others to have a good time with it.
